titleOfInvention |
Method for preparing matrix-typed granular slow-release compound fertilizer and matrix-typed granular slow-release compound fertilizer obtained by the method |
abstract |
The present invention relates to a process for producing a matrix-type granular compound fertilizer having a long-lasting effect with an increased utilization rate of fertilizer and a matrix-type granular compound fertilizer obtained therefrom. The method according to the present invention is characterized in that a natural or synthetic polymer and an extender Mixing, drying and pulverizing the mixture to prepare an additive capable of absorbing nutrients; And mixing and drying the nutrient-absorbing additive and the fertilizer component uniformly to produce a matrix-type granular compound fertilizer. |
